Style and uniqueness of the art print
Ribera, master of chiaroscuro, employs striking contrasts to create a dramatic atmosphere. In "Saint Jerome," shadows envelop the figure, emphasizing his features marked by age and wisdom. The color palette, dominated by warm, earthy tones, enhances this sense of depth and realism. Every detail, from the open book to the saint's hands and the texture of his clothing, demonstrates meticulous observation and remarkable technical skill. The piece does not merely depict a saint; it tells a story, that of a man in search of truth, isolated in his reflections. This narrative approach, combined with masterful execution, grants "Saint Jerome" a prominent place in the pantheon of Baroque works.
The artist and his influence
Jusepe de Ribera, often associated with the Spanish school of painting, left a lasting mark on his era through a unique vision and unparalleled technique. Born in Valencia, he quickly established himself as one of the great masters of the Baroque, influencing many contemporary and future artists. His style, characterized by striking realism and bold use of light, paved the way for a new way of representing human emotions.
